Exhibit at White River Valley Museum houses hidden treasures
Exhibit at White River Valley Museum houses a ‘who’s who’ of Japanese-heritage Washington artists in a compact jewel of a show | Walk into Auburn’s White River Valley Museum and you never know what you’ll see. Local wedding paraphernalia? A Victorian coffin? 1950s swimsuits? But to walk in this spring and see art by Akio Takamori, Patti Warashina, Gerard Tsutakawa, Paul Horiuchi and Roger Shimomura – just to name five – in one compact room was a joyful surprise.
